Our Mission.

To improve the lives of 1Million children by 2030 by providing them access to exceptional early learning experiences regardless of their background, financial circumstances or location.

Our Vision.

Woodlands envisions a future where every child, regardless of background, thrives through access to exceptional early education. We commit to fostering lifelong learners, compassionate individuals, and future community leaders through play-based learning and intentional, evidence-based learning.

Our Pedagogy.

At Woodlands, we honour the unique learning styles and abilities of each child, nurturing them with respect and collaboration to ensure every child has the opportunity to thrive in their own way. We believe in planting seeds of lifelong attitudes, skills, and behaviours through our dedicated work with children and families, driven by our vision for a better world. Our commitment includes fostering inclusivity, equality, and a secure environment for all, alongside nurturing a deep understanding of cultural knowledge to empower and broaden perspectives within the Woodlands community.

Our mission at Woodlands is to support all children by empowering them to express themselves through intentional, play-based learning strategies. These strategies not only enhance their knowledge but also foster positive attitudes towards learning and strengthening their identity. We provide children with opportunities to grow and expand their learning in thriving environments, ensuring they receive the best educational experiences. At Woodlands we promote sustainability through daily practices of recycling and up-cycling, as well as encouraging environmental responsibility throughout our community.

As Educators at Woodlands, we embrace agility and reflection and adapting to an evolving world. Guided by our core values, we are committed to delivering the highest quality education and outcomes for children, families, and our local community. Our community thrives on diverse experiences, languages, and perspectives, including our own culturally diverse educators, fostering a collaborative learning environment where every voice is valued and supported. Our partnerships with the Woodlands community are built on mutual respect, shared values, and leveraging each other’s strengths in knowledge and skills.
